Today's fable at Latin Via Fables is Piscator et Pisciculus: The Fisherman and The Little Fish. You can visit the Latin Via Fables page to see the Latin text, English translation and some grammar help.

Word List. Here is an alphabetical word list of the Latin words included in the puzzle:
certus, commodum, commutare, demittere, donec, fatigare, fides, futilis, grandescere, hospes, incertus, insulsus, lautus, lubricus, piscator, pisciculus, piscis, prex, sane, spes

Here are the clues:

ACROSS

1 Host; friend, guest
3 Vague, uncertain
5 Advantage, use
7 Tasteless, foolish
10 To grow big
13 To weary, harass
14 Fisherman
15 Definite, certain
16 Hope
17 Slippery, unreliable
18 Until, so long as

DOWN

2 Fish
4 To exchange, change
6 Trust, belief
8 Little fish
9 To let go, set free
11 Worthless, untrustworthy
12 Washed, refined, elegant
14 Request, entreaty
16 Really, surely
